Pyro


I forget how much I enjoy Earl Emerson's books until I read another one. If you have not read anything by him, I suggest you start with Into the Inferno--one of his absolute best. Last weekend I read Pyro, and it starts with one of the most intriguing first sentences I have read in a while, "Life has been a rocky road since that morning nineteen years ago when my brother and I killed Alfred." Now Lt. Paul Wolff is a Seattle firefighter who hates pyromaniacs because his father was killed in a fire started by one when Paul was a child. This tragic death triggered the ruination of his family. Currently the city is being plagued by a string of fires that seem to be very similar to the ones nineteen years ago, and Paul is determined to catch the culprit and hopefully his father's killer.

Last Chance Harvey


Last Chance Harvey with Dustin Hoffman and Emma Thompson is a story about friendship, love, and last chances. Harvey flies to London for his daughter's wedding where he meets a surveyor at the airport. They start talking over lunch and immediately connect with each other. Both of them aren't satisfied with their lives, both of them want things to be a little different, and now might be their last chance.
